Dead Fob Battery

Car key fobs have gotten quite smart however, this doesn't mean that they won't sometimes get stuck in the "not responding" zone. It's time to replace your battery when this happens. It's not a solution since there may be a bad connection at one of the terminals on the battery connector.

The car keys repair near me manufacturers are aware of the potential issue, and often install an extra mechanical key inside the fob for use in the event of an emergency. You can access it by pressing the small release button or latch behind the fob. (Check the user manual for more details). When you press this button, you will be able to open the fob to reveal a key that you can use to open the car.

Another sign that your fob's battery is dying is that you need to be a lot closer to your car in order to open and lock it than you did before. This is because the transmitter of your fob loses its strength when its battery dies and limits its operating range.

It's relatively simple to replace the battery. You'll need a button-cell battery (which looks like a small silver coin) and follow the directions in the user's manual to take out the old battery. Replace the battery in the same direction as the original one (the positive side facing up toward the buttons). After reassembling the fob, test its start, lock and unlock functions to make sure that the battery was installed correctly.

You can access key fobs by looking for the latch, screw, or switch at the back and then prying the fob in two. Be careful not to break the fob since you'll require it to operate your car! If you're not comfortable doing this yourself, you can also send your key fob to an expert. Since it's a routine service the majority of auto shops will change the battery on a fob for a nominal fee. Some dealers will even offer it for free depending on the make and model of your vehicle.

Fob Is Not Working

The first thing to do when your key fob isn't working is to replace the batteries. This is the most straightforward fix and most likely what will fix the problem. If your device is not functioning after a battery change, it may be due to damage or Key Fob Repair Service another issue that requires attention from a professional.

Damage can occur to the car key fob for many reasons including physical trauma, exposure to water, or a damaged circuit board. These issues can prevent your key from sending a signal to the vehicle's receiver which can then stop your car's doors or ignition from opening or even starting. You may have to hire a professional to replace your fob if it is damaged.

Similarly, the buttons on your device may have become worn out over time with repeated use. The rubber may wear out and cause the buttons to become less responsive or clicky and may begin to fail to register your press accurately. You may try wiping them down and adjusting them, however, it is recommended to get the fob examined by a professional to make more extensive repairs.

You should also double check that the new battery you're using is a exact match for your fob. You can find a list online or in a majority of hardware stores. Refer to the owner's guide or the engraving on your fob for more information. If the battery isn't the correct fit, it may have issues transmitting strong signals or providing enough power to internal components.

In some cases, the problem could be in the vehicle's electronic parts or receiver. If you have an inductive backup system, you can test it by opening the door with a physical key and then beginning the car key repair using the inductive backup (if there is). If the physical key you have not allow you to start your car, have a mechanic inspect the electronic components and the receiver to ensure that they're functioning properly.

Fob Is Damaged

A key fob contains numerous components that function together and a single malfunction can cause other parts to fail. If a keyfob stops working it's crucial to check for obvious causes like cracks in the casing or a damaged component. It's also essential to examine other areas of the vehicle such as the lights and horn to determine whether they're working as expected.

If the fob for your key is damaged, you should obtain a replacement from your dealer or an auto locksmith rather than trying to fix it. It might be necessary to reprogramme the fob to the car. This isn't something you can do at home and requires special equipment.

Over time the contacts on the buttons of a key fob may wear out. This is especially common if the fob is dropped or left in hot temperatures.

The internal wiring of a key fob could also become worn out over time. This could lead to the button not functioning when it's pressed or only working when press very hard. It could also result in the car remote key repair shop near me not opening or locking when the fob is pressed.

The majority of key fobs have the cover in plastic, which can be removed and cleaned safely by using soap and warm water. This is a great way to help restore a key fob's functioning properly and it's a good idea to do it often to prevent dirt from damaging the insides.

A faulty battery is typically the reason why a key fob will not turn on or work. The majority of car dealers and mechanics are able to replace the battery quickly. If you are comfortable with the installation then you can buy an additional one from the big-box or a hardware store, and follow the instructions on YouTube or in the owner's manual.

The worst-case scenario is that the key fob has internal damage, for example cracks in the case, tiny electronic car key repair near me components not completely attached to the circuit board or corroded or bent contact points for batteries. If any of the above is the case, it's a good idea to consult with an auto locksmith or dealer for advice on a replacement and help getting it programmed to your vehicle.
